Nkisi Power Sculpture
African Art Nkisi Nkondi Nail Fetish Figure, Power Figure From The Bakongo People In Zaire, Congo. This Power Figure Sculpture Is Carved Wood With Glass Detailed Belly And Eyes And Wrapped Textile Neck And Hips. Entire Body Of Figure Is Punctured With Metal Nails.

‘Nkisi Nkondi Figures Are Highly Recognizable Through An Accumulation Of Pegs, Blades, Nails Or Other Sharp Objects Inserted Into Its Surface. Medicinal Combinations Called Bilongo Are Sometimes Stored In The Head Of The Figure But Frequently In The Belly Of The Figure Which Is Shielded By A Piece Of Glass, Mirror Or Other Reflective Surface. The Glass Represents The ‘Other World’ Inhabited By The Spirits Of The Dead Who Can Peer Through And See Potential Enemies.
